Abstract

Cloud computing represents a huge potential for creating new business value for all those who are willing and able to implement the technical, cultural and organizational change needed to adopt a new concept. The cost reduction argument in business does not list the end users for access to cloud, but the argument for the flexible use of IT resources. In today's practice, cloud is applied to applications, for example, for testing and development systems, in the form of a training for employees or an infrastructure reserve, i.e. due to the increased need for data storage, although other cloud applications (such as CRM or collaborative applications) are increasingly being applied, while bypassing the IT sector. Enterprises should advance this trend for security and legal reasons by introducing proactively CC into their strategic planning. The financial calculation and profitability of cloud computing is calculated for each case individually and depends on the existing conditions and business requirements of the company.
